This was Anita Brookner's first novel. I have read most of her books. In her early writing. it became evident her prose had compassion and feeling. i had empathy for the characters, and with ease felt the harsh weather that at times that I miss residing in Florida.
if one has not read anything by her, i highly recommend you experience her prose. Sadly she passed away a few years ago.
